Kanu heads to Japan

Nwankwo Kanu is to move to the Japanese league at the end of his contract with English Premiership giants Arsenal, if reports from Japan are to be believed.

According to the sports newspaper Sports Nippon, Kanu has agreed a deal to join top J-League outfit JEF United Ichihara.

He is to replace South Korea international striker Choi Yong-Soo, who has moved to rivals Kyoto Purple Sanga.

The report quoted a player agent who said everything has been worked out with the Super Eagles World Cup star.

JEF United were founded in June 1991 and have been featuring in the J-League since then.

They are owned by Furukawa Electric Company and East Japan Railway. Kanu joined Arsenal from Inter Milan in 1998. He has been named African Footballer of the Year twice, in 1996 and 1999.

Last year, Kanu, who has failed to command a regular first team shirt at the London Gunners, was linked with a big-money move to the Far east.
